Bill Text: TX HB599 | 2015-2016 | 84th Legislature | Engrossed
Bill Title: Relating to energy savings performance contracts entered into by public institutions of higher education.
Sponsorship: Partisan Bill (Republican 1)
Status: (Engrossed - Dead) 2015-05-20 - Referred to Business & Commerce [HB599 Detail]

| (i-1) The guidelines established under Subsection (i) must | ||
| require that the cost savings projected by an offeror be reviewed by | ||
| a licensed professional engineer who has a minimum of three years of | ||
| experience in energy calculation and review, is not an officer or | ||
| employee of an offeror for the contract under review, and is not | ||
| otherwise associated with the contract. In conducting the review, | ||
| the engineer shall focus primarily on the proposed improvements | ||
| from an engineering perspective, the methodology and calculations | ||
| related to cost savings, increases in revenue, and, if applicable, | ||
| efficiency or accuracy of metering equipment. An engineer who | ||
| reviews a contract shall maintain the confidentiality of any | ||
| proprietary information the engineer acquires while reviewing the | ||
| contract. Sections 1001.053 and 1001.407, Occupations Code, apply | ||
| to work performed under the contract. | ||

| (l) The guidelines established under Subsection (i) must | ||
| require the State Energy Conservation Office [ |
||
|
|
||
| (1) review any reports submitted to the office [ |
||
| that measure and verify cost savings to an institution of higher | ||
| education under an energy savings performance contract; and | ||
| (2) based on the reports, provide an analysis, on a | ||
| periodic basis, of the cost savings under the energy savings | ||
| performance contract to the governing board of the institution of | ||
| higher education and the Legislative Budget Board until the | ||
| governing board of the institution of higher education determines | ||
| that the analysis is no longer required to accurately measure cost | ||
| savings. | ||
| SECTION 2. The change in law made by this Act to Section | ||
| 51.927, Education Code, does not apply to an energy savings | ||
| performance contract submitted for approval by the Texas Higher | ||
| Education Coordinating Board under that section before the | ||
| effective date of this Act, and the former law governing the | ||
| approval of that contract is continued in effect for that purpose. | ||
| SECTION 3. This Act takes effect September 1, 2015. | ||
